What problem does it solve?

PDD Entropy Reduction Agent coordinates a governance workflow to continuously identify and reduce entropy, including outdated documentation, architecture drift, and debt, by orchestrating specialized sub-skills and producing actionable reports.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Coordinated governance: a central coordinator delegates work to specialized skills (doc-gardener, arch-enforcer, entropy-auditor, auto-refactor) to produce consistent results.
  • Comprehensive detection: monitors documentation consistency, architectural boundaries, and code quality to surface drift, violations, and inefficiencies.
  • Automated reporting & remediation planning: emits structured entropy reports with prior/after metrics and recommended actions for fixes.

Quick Start

Run the entropy_scan.py script against your project to generate an entropy reduction report.
